The HyperX Pulsefire Haste 2 comes with grip tape, which you can apply for better… grip.
The wired version has an MSRP of $59.99 while the wireless one goes for $89.99.
Considering its performance and features this is a very good price point for this gaming mouse.

Rubbery grip tape and smooth PTFE mouse skates are included in the box for optional system.
The textured grip is comfortable and makes the mouse feel more in my control than before they were applied.
The Haste 2 utilizes the HyperX 26K Sensor, which offers high-precision aiming.
